Villegas for Congress is hiring a Deputy Finance Director for the period leading up to the general election on November 3, 2026 in California’s 22nd Congressional District. The ideal applicant has relevant campaign experience, works well in fast-paced environments, and has a proven track record of hitting set goals. ** This is a full-time, salaried, cycle-based exempt position located in Bakersfield, CA.**
Responsibilities will include:
Collaborating with and assisting the Finance Director
Work with hosts and key partners to plan, coordinate and execute fundraisers
Draft fundraising materials in the candidate’s voice such as letters, texts and emails
Staff events in-district and occasional travel trips
Staff call time sessions and coach the candidate through his pitch and ask
Perform donor research and prepare lists for call time sessions
Other duties and responsibilities as assigned
